When the Spreadsheet Catches Fire: The Risks of Manual Data Maintenance
As soon as order volume increases, cracks appear in the foundation of spreadsheet management. In multichannel sales, small oversights quickly turn into major capital errors.
Synchronization Chaos: Why Excel Never Knows What is Happening on Amazon
- If a product sells simultaneously on eBay and in your shop, your Excel spreadsheet remains unaware until you manually change the entry.
- In the meantime, Amazon continues to display the old stock level, which inevitably leads to overselling items you physically do not have.
- This “flying blind” means you live in constant fear of the next order instead of celebrating your success.
- A spreadsheet possesses no logic to set priorities or intelligently reserve stock between different channels.
Data Loss and Formula Errors: How One Small Click Can Ruin Your Entire Inventory
- Excel files are fragile; a wrong key combination or accidentally deleting a formula can destroy the calculations for your entire assortment.
- Without a real database structure, there is no versioning or rollback function to protect you from fatal user errors.
- Shared spreadsheets in the cloud often lead to synchronization conflicts where important data changes are simply overwritten.
- A faulty cell reference in price calculation can lead to you selling your goods below cost without noticing it immediately.

JTL-Wawi: More Than Just a List – Your Digital Brain
An ERP system is not just a “better Excel.” It is an intelligent ecosystem that structures and secures your entire company.
Structured Data Management: How JTL-Wawi Brings Order to Items, Customers, and Orders
- In a database, information is logically linked; a customer belongs to an order, which in turn is linked to an item.
- This structure allows for complex evaluations that would be impossible with Excel, such as analyzing the repurchase rate of specific customer groups.
- All historical data remains securely stored and searchable at any time, which is essential for customer support and accounting.
- Centralized data management prevents duplicates and ensures that everyone on the team is always on the same page as the company grows.
The Basis for Automation: Why Workflows Require a Database Foundation
- Workflows in JTL-Wawi function like “If-Then” rules that access your database to make logical decisions.
- Example: If an order comes from abroad, the system automatically selects the appropriate logistics provider and prints the customs documents.
- This intelligence can never be replicated with Excel, as a spreadsheet lacks the connection to external systems and logic checks.
- A database is the foundation on which you can build complex automations that keep your business running even at night.

Data Import Made Easy: How to Cleanly Transfer Your Excel Lists into JTL-Wawi
- With JTL-Ameise, JTL-Wawi offers a powerful tool developed specifically for importing Excel data.
- You don’t have to re-type your data; a structured CSV import is enough to lift your entire assortment into the database.
- The system checks for errors during import and ensures your data is cleanly and consistently structured from the start.
